2. Business ventures
Are you planning to start a business? No matter the size, ensuring its success for the next few years will require all the help available. It may seem too early to hire an accountant, but their expert advice can help shape your company’s future. Local accountants have the advantage of knowing local policies and accounting standards that companies should comply with to avoid legal liabilities. They can help you understand the business structure available, choose one that fits your needs, and set up rules and tax accounts that follow government regulations.

5. Government Paperwork
If you’re running a business, it’s highly likely that you’ll need to submit documents to the government. An accountant can help you complete and file any documents that your business needs to operate legally. During the course of the operation, they can also ensure you’re updated with the latest tax laws, prepare your annual statements of accounts, and maintain records. They will also help you stay on track of any annual renewals and registrations you need to comply with. It’s easy to miss these things with all the tasks you need to juggle in running your business.
